After hours of emptying the tank and trying everything I could think of, including putting a rock on the shock to hold it in place with more force, I finally figured it all out. These seals sometimes appear to come from the factory with a "wave" or "bubble" around the edge. This allows a small amount of water to seep through the seal and eventually drain the tank. I was removing the new seal and examining it when someone else mentioned swollen seal edges. It was barely noticeable. You can feel it during installation by running your finger along the outer edge of the gasket. Anything that isn't perfectly smooth can cause a leak. I went back to the packaging and pulled out the 3rd seal and it was smooth. replaced. Problem solved.
